Mesothelioma is a form of cancer that is caused by inhaling asbestos fibers. The asbestos fibers encase the tissue, and [empty] cause a cell mutation. This process can take several years to develop and may not be evident until later.

The Department of Veterans Affairs offers numerous benefits for veterans suffering from asbestos-related illnesses. Some of them include financial compensation, special monthly payments for family members, as well as dependency payments for a veteran’s spouse or children. Trust will pay claims of asbestos victims

An asbestos trust fund might be accessible to you if are an asbestos victim. These funds have been put by asbestos-based manufacturers products, and they are designed to assist you in getting compensation for your suffering and losses. Asbestos trusts are meant to pay a small portion of the value of your claim each year, which is why you should think about filing your claim sooner rather than later.

Getting a claim approved can be a lengthy process, therefore it’s essential to make sure you have all the documents needed to justify your claim. This includes a physician’s explanation of your diagnosis along with medical records and employment documents. You might be wondering who is accountable when someone you know suffers from mesothelioma. This kind of cancer is caused from asbestos exposure and can be extremely costly to treat. You could be eligible for compensation for mesothelioma. This can help you pay your medical bills and lost wages.

The value of your lawsuit is contingent on several factors. Your legal team can assist you to determine the value of your mesothelioma lawsuit.

The type of mesothelioma that you are suffering from will also play an important role in the amount you’ll be able to receive in compensation. The most costly cases of the disease are typically worth more. The amount you receive will also be contingent on how many dependents you have.

Depending on your state the statute of limitations for filing an asbestos lawsuit can vary. It is best to talk to an experienced law firm if you suspect you have an asbestos-related case.

Usually the party accountable for your mesothelioma exposure is the manufacturer or the seller of the asbestos-containing product. You may be able to sue when you were exposed while working with the product.
